How much does it cost to run a society or group on Golfshake.com?

So long as you have a Premium account (£9.95 (GBP)) you can run your group with unlimited managed accounts.

If you upgraded to the £49.95 (GBP) group account, then this gives you and up to 7 members access to the Premium service plus the handicap member card which is part of the Platinum service.
Additional cards for each member can be purchased at £4.95 (GBP) but discounts can be applied.

If any of your members wanted to have their own Golfshake account then they can just use the free service and upgrade to the Premium or Platinum if they wanted.

Can I add rounds for my friend? Or do they have to become a member to record their own rounds?

You can add rounds for your friends. If you login and access the tools section you will find a link for 'Multiple Account Management ' you can then create accounts for your friends. When you add a round you use the normal system but on the score entry you will see that Player A allows a drop down which defaults to you but allows you to select the accounts you manage.

If you are planning to track more than 2 friends I'd recommend checking out the group system, that way you can the compare and view stats/rounds in one place:http://www.golfshake.com/help/group/

Delete Groups Rounds

To delete a members round view your society managed accounts. You will see a config icon  for maintenance and from there you can then view your members rounds and delete a round.
